Web10 jun. 2024 · Reheat the chicken for 3 to 4 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king. Keep an eye on the chicken especially at the last minutes of reheating. You’ll only want to make them crispy again, not burn them to a crisp. Pro-tip: if this is your first time reheating chicken, you may need to do a test run. Web15 mrt. 2024 · Reheat chicken wings in air fryer The biggest thing to keep in mind when reheating food in air fryer is that you need to give the food space for the hot air to circulate. It doesn’t matter if you have the heat setting at 350 degrees or 400 degrees, if you don’t give the chicken room, it’s not going to crisp up. cylinder bore wash
